| Mary S. Young Park | Mary S. Young Park offers you a peaceful place to walk or sit by the Willamette River. About 128 acres, this quiet, forested park is a favorite for urban birders. As you walk deeper into the forest on the numerous trails (5-8 miles worth), it’s easy to forget you’re in a city. ![]() | West Linn Skate Park | The West Linn Skate park is known for its large, fast bowls and its huge oververt. There also is a nice shallow area with a pyramid and many street objects including a four stair, ledges, and a rail. ![]() | Camassia Nature Preserve | Camassia Natural Area is a 22.5 acre natural area owned and maintained by the Nature Conservancy. This nature area offers unique and rare plant species, wildlife viewing, and hiking trails.
